Winter storm Bruce couldn't stop them
Driving back from WV to Colorado in November of 2018 we ran into winter storm "Bruce" that hammered Kansas and Missouri with ice and snow. We were driving our mid-height roof 2016 Ford Transit and passed by a whole lot of folks who obviously didn't have the tires to deal with the slick roads as they were either in the median or in a ditch. Ice grip was tremendous, and I think the traction control only ever came on once momentarily while I was accelerating from a stop on a hill. Snow traction was great also, and it seems to drive better on slick roads than my AWD Escape does with stock all seasons. Even with 30-40 mph winds hitting the side of the van it stayed stable and on the road, so we were very thankful to get home safely.
